Masks: What's okay?

All students who come to school must have masks that fit their face snugly. Please do not give your child an adult mask that is too big. Also, masks with valves are not allowed at school. If your child needs a replacement mask during the school day, we can provide one. Masks must be worn on all buses and throughout the day, except for eating.

Challenging Behaviors at Home

The Mount Eagle Student Support Team will be virtually presenting “Challenging Behaviors: Strategies for Home” on March 24th at 6 PM (English) and 7 PM (Spanish). All parents and caregivers are welcome to attend! We will be sharing how to identify a power struggle, different strategies to handle them, and the 1-2-3 Magic approach.
